House Fire Aspendale. Corner of Station St and Pine Court.
I was told by neighbours and onlookers that squatters have been living here but left a couple of weeks ago, they have been seen and heard coming back and trashing the house. There appeared to be a car in the shed at the rear but this could have been next doors. I was also told that the house was going to be knocked down soon and a new property built but thats not confirmed. Both the MFB and CFA worked together as this is the area that borders both fire services. I was also told that one person was unaccounted for and that they were going to have to check what was left of the house. CFA and Police cordoned off the area and donned masks could be due to Asbestos. As I was leaving quite a number of Police cars arrived including detectives. Station Street was blocked off to traffic. It would be best to call Moorabbin Police regarding this fire.
